I think posture is pretty good. It does look like it is forced but that's how adaptation is created. What may looked forced now will look very relaxed, smooth and effortless in a week or so. Remember that for rowers the erg is somewhere to really focus on technique and strengthening postural muscles. You do not want a relaxed "core" or mid section as that is the area of transfer of power from legs to the hands/handle-blade in water and therefore you do want a pole up the back.
